How much does it cost to hire an ADU builder in Berkeley Springs?

ADU construction costs in Berkeley Springs, West Virginia vary widely depending on size, type, and site conditions. Detached ADUs typically range from $150,000–$400,000+, while garage conversions and attached ADUs can be more affordable. How long does it take to build an ADU in Berkeley Springs?

In Berkeley Springs, the ADU construction timeline typically ranges from 6 to 18 months from permit application to move-in. Permitting alone can take 2–6 months depending on West Virginia local regulations. Prefab and modular ADUs often have faster timelines than site-built units.

What types of ADUs can be built in Berkeley Springs?

Common ADU types in Berkeley Springs include detached ADUs (backyard cottages), attached ADUs, garage conversions, basement conversions, and prefab/modular ADUs. The best type for your property depends on lot size, zoning, and budget. A local Berkeley Springs ADU builder can advise on what's allowed on your specific parcel.
